A Sweet Ending
Whether you have passed the pie making on to an expected guest, called a baker that you love, or have decided to make your own - to go totally "over the top", you could serve your pie slices with a scoop of homemade quince ice cream. This version can be made a day in advance and does not require a custard base. If you saved the poaching liquid from the quince and apple crumble we posted a few weeks ago, it can be used in this recipe. Whole slices of poached quince would also be deliciously good served alongside as well.

Tip: Pumpkins, pears, sweet potatoes, quince, apples, and pecans, are all in season. Any of these would make a delicious pie. Remember, pies can be made a day ahead and refrigerated. Pull them out of the refrigerator 1 hour before serving. Or, if you are short on time, a good old-fashioned crumble is delicious too.
